+1 for Ikea boxes. Depending on the size, the box runs between $20-40, in white or "birch effect". Yes it's melamine coated particle board, but as long as you don't plan to drown the cabs, it's fine. As a bonus, the shelf holes are pre-drilled for ya.
The Ikea hardware (hinges, drawer slides, etc.) is Blum, and it's good. Just add your own custom doors and you're golden.
We redid our kitchen about 9 months ago with Ikea carcasses and custom doors. Brilliant. And certainly much easier and faster than building the boxes myself.
